Delhi: Five Arrested For Assault On Africans

New Delhi: On Sunday, the police arrested five persons in connection with the attack on Africans in Delhi. The attackers were identified as Om Prakash, Ajay, Rahul, Babu and a juvenile. According to police, on Thursday night, six people were injured in three different incidents in Mehrauli. One from Uganda and the other from South Africa and at least two Nigerian men are among the complainants.

External Affairs Minister Sushma Swaraj reacted to the incident. In a series of tweets, she said,” I have spoken to Shri Raj Nath Singhji and Lt. Governor Delhi regarding the attack on African nationals in South Delhi yesterday. They assured me that the culprits will be arrested soon and sensitization campaign will be launched in areas where African nationals reside.”

Union Home Minister Rajnath Singh also condemned the attack and has spoken to “CP Delhi regarding the incident of physical assault against certain African nationals in New Delhi.”
